6  Everyone is permitted to copy and distribute verbatim copies
11 The licenses for most software are designed to take away your
12 freedom to share and change it. By contrast, the GNU General Public
13 License is intended to guarantee your freedom to share and change free
14 software--to make sure the software is free for all its users. This
15 General Public License applies to most of the Free Software
16 Foundation's software and to any other program whose authors commit to
18 the GNU Library General Public License instead.) You can apply it to
21 When we speak of free software, we are referring to freedom, not
22 price. Our General Public Licenses are designed to make sure that you
23 have the freedom to distribute copies of free software (and charge for
28 To protect your rights, we need to make restrictions that forbid
29 anyone to deny you these rights or to ask you to surrender the rights.
30 These restrictions translate to certain responsibilities for you if you
40 (2) offer you this license which gives you legal permission to copy,
43 Also, for each author's protection and ours, we want to make certain
46 want its recipients to know that what they have is not the original, so
51 patents. We wish to avoid the danger that redistributors of a free
63 0. This License applies to any program or other work which contains
66 refers to any such program or work, and a "work based on the Program"
68 that is to say, a work containing the Program or a portion of it,
84 notices that refer to this License and to the absence of any warranty;
96 a) You must cause the modified files to carry prominent notices
101 part thereof, to be licensed as a whole at no charge to all third
106 interactive use in the most ordinary way, to print or display an
110 these conditions, and telling the user how to view a copy of this
113 the Program is not required to print an announcement.)
116 These requirements apply to the modified work as a whole. If
119 themselves, then this License, and its terms, do not apply to those
123 this License, whose permissions for other licensees extend to the
124 entire whole, and thus to each and every part regardless of who wrote it.
126 Thus, it is not the intent of this section to claim rights or contest
127 your rights to work written entirely by you; rather, the intent is to
128 exercise the right to control the distribution of derivative or
145 years, to give any third party, for a charge no more than your
147 machine-readable copy of the corresponding source code, to be
151 c) Accompany it with the information you received as to the offer
152 to distribute corresponding source code. (This alternative is
158 making modifications to it. For an executable work, complete source
160 associated interface definition files, plus the scripts used to
169 access to copy from a designated place, then offering equivalent
170 access to copy the source code from the same place counts as
172 compelled to copy the source along with the object code.
177 otherwise to copy, modify, sublicense or distribute the Program is
183 5. You are not required to accept this License, since you have not
184 signed it. However, nothing else grants you permission to modify or
188 Program), you indicate your acceptance of this License to do so, and
194 original licensor to copy, distribute or modify the Program subject to
197 You are not responsible for enforcing compliance by third parties to
201 infringement or for any other reason (not limited to patent issues),
205 distribute so as to satisfy simultaneously your obligations under this
210 the only way you could satisfy both it and this License would be to
214 any particular circumstance, the balance of the section is intended to
215 apply and the section as a whole is intended to apply in other
218 It is not the purpose of this section to induce you to infringe any
219 patents or other property right claims or to contest validity of any
223 generous contributions to the wide range of software distributed
225 system; it is up to the author/donor to decide if he or she is willing
226 to distribute software through any other system and a licensee cannot
229 This section is intended to make thoroughly clear what is believed to
242 of the General Public License from time to time. Such new versions will
243 be similar in spirit to the present version, but may differ in detail to
247 specifies a version number of this License which applies to it and "any
254 10. If you wish to incorporate parts of the Program into other free
255 programs whose distribution conditions are different, write to the author
256 to ask for permission. For software which is copyrighted by the Free
257 Software Foundation, write to the Free Software Foundation; we sometimes
287 How to Apply These Terms to Your New Programs
289 If you develop a new program, and you want it to be of the greatest
290 possible use to the public, the best way to achieve this is to make it
293 To do so, attach the following notices to the program. It is safest
294 to attach them to the start of each source file to most effectively
296 the "copyright" line and a pointer to where the full notice is found.
298 <one line to give the program's name and a brief idea of what it does.>
312 along with this program; if not, write to the Free Software
316 Also add information on how to contact you by electronic and paper mail.
323 This is free software, and you are welcome to redistribute it
332 school, if any, to sign a "copyright disclaimer" for the program, if
343 consider it more useful to permit linking proprietary applications with the
344 library. If this is what you want to do, use the GNU Library General